#!/usr/bin/env bash
|
||||
#
|
||||
# Parses DHCP options from openvpn to update resolv.conf
|
||||
# To use set as 'up' and 'down' script in your openvpn *.conf:
|
||||
# up /etc/openvpn/update-resolv-conf
|
||||
# down /etc/openvpn/update-resolv-conf
|
||||
#
|
||||
# Used snippets of resolvconf script by Thomas Hood <jdthood@yahoo.co.uk>
|
||||
# and Chris Hanson
|
||||
# Licensed under the GNU GPL. See /usr/share/common-licenses/GPL.
|
||||
# 07/2013 colin@daedrum.net Fixed intet name
|
||||
# 05/2006 chlauber@bnc.ch
|
||||
#
|
||||
# Example envs set from openvpn:
|
||||
# foreign_option_1='dhcp-option DNS 193.43.27.132'
|
||||
# foreign_option_2='dhcp-option DNS 193.43.27.133'
|
||||
# foreign_option_3='dhcp-option DOMAIN be.bnc.ch'
|
||||
# foreign_option_4='dhcp-option DOMAIN-SEARCH bnc.local'
